Treloar’s is a UK charity offering education, therapy, and care to 180 physically disabled young people aged 4–25. We create a supportive, inclusive environment where students with complex clinical needs can learn, grow, and gain independence through tailored programmes.

We are cycling from Cork to Dublin (approximately 236 miles) to raise money for Treloar Trust which provides education, therapy, medical support and training in independence for young people with physical disabilities. The aim of the Trust is to give students the opportunity to develop their confidence and skills to enable them to achieve their potential in all aspects of life.

All of the sponsorship money raised from the bike ride will go to support Treloar's Pushing the Boundaries programme which sends groups of students from Treloar School to specialist activity centres for an adrenaline packed week when even the most disabled students can have an opportunity to experience a wide variety of outdoor challenges including abseiling, climbing, sailing, zip wire (all in a wheelchair), orienteering and canoeing. As well as the physical challenge, confidence-building, communication, trust, responsibility, team-working, safe risk-taking and coping in new situations are all on the agenda, plus an academic dimension, with the course work undertaken contributing to a variety of nationally recognised qualifications.

We think that Pushing the Boundaries is a wonderful programme, providing an amazing opportunity for the students. Every £1,000 that we raise from the bike ride will fund a place on the programme for a Treloar's student.
